Darmowy szablon automatyzacji

Synchronizuj adresy URL filmów z YouTube z Arkuszami Google

75
1 mies. temu
8
bloków

```html

Sync Youtube Videos with Google Sheets

To jest pierwsza część wieloetapowego systemu automatyzacji, zaprojektowanego do przeprowadzania analizy sentymentu komentarzy na YouTube na dużą skalę wraz ze szczegółowym panelem danych. Rozwiązuje problem ręcznego śledzenia nowych filmów na wielu kanałach YouTube, automatycznie pobierając i organizując adresy URL filmów w arkuszu Google, przygotowując grunt pod głębszą analizę w części 2.

Co robi ten szablon?

  • Odczytuje identyfikatory kanałów z Arkusza3 podłączonego arkusza Google.
  • Pobiera najnowsze filmy z każdego kanału za pomocą YouTube Data API.
  • Wyodrębnia adresy URL filmów oraz metadane (np. tytuł i datę publikacji).
  • Dodaje dane filmów do Arkusza2 tego samego arkusza Google – ten arkusz jest później wykorzystywany w części 2 do dalszego przetwarzania.

Część wieloetapowego systemu

To część 1 systemu składającego się z 2 workflow:

  • Część 1 (ten workflow) wypełnia arkusz najnowszymi filmami z listy kanałów.
  • Część 2 odczytuje adresy URL filmów z Arkusza2, pobiera komentarze do każdego filmu, analizuje ich sentyment za pomocą OpenAI i zapisuje ustrukturyzowane wyniki w Arkuszu1.

Przykłady zastosowań

Ten szablon automatyzacji może być wykorzystany w różnych scenariuszach, takich jak:

  • Monitorowanie i organizowanie nowych filmów z listy kanałów YouTube.
  • Automatyzacja procesów związanych z treściami dla zespołów mediów społecznościowych i analityków.
  • Budowa skalowalnych zbiorów danych do analizy komentarzy i sentymentu.
  • Idealne rozwiązanie dla twórców, agencji lub analityków danych zarządzających wieloma kontami YouTube.
  • Śledzenie wydajności treści w czasie.
  • Automatyczne generowanie raportów o nowościach na kanałach.
  • Integracja z innymi narzędziami analitycznymi w celu głębszego badania zaangażowania widzów.

Wykorzystywane aplikacje

  • Google Sheets – do odczytu i zapisu danych dotyczących kanałów/filmów.
  • YouTube – do pobierania danych filmów z publicznych kanałów.

Dlaczego warto użyć tego szablonu?

Ręczne sprawdzanie kanałów YouTube pod kątem nowych treści jest czasochłonne i podatne na błędy. Ta automatyzacja zapewnia aktualne i ustrukturyzowane dane, umożliwiając spójne śledzenie i głębszą analizę (szczególnie w połączeniu z częścią 2). Dzięki niej Twoje operacje związane z treściami na YouTube zyskują na szybkości, skali i automatyzacji.

Jak dostosować szablon?

1. Modyfikacja ustawień wyzwalacza

Zmień wpisy identyfikatorów kanałów w Arkuszu3, aby śledzić inne kanały. Użyj wyzwalacza czasowego, aby regularnie pobierać nowe filmy, zapewniając aktualność danych.

2. Dostosowanie pól wyjściowych

Pobierz dodatkowe informacje z YouTube, takie jak liczba wyświetleń, opis lub miniatury. Dodaj niestandardowe kolumny w Arkuszu2, aby organizować filmy według różnych kryteriów, takich jak:

  • Data publikacji
  • Typ filmu
  • Liczba wyświetleń
  • Opis filmu

3. Rozszerzenie o integracje

Zintegruj z innymi workflow, takimi jak analiza sentymentu komentarzy YouTube (część 2), aby pogłębić analizę treści. Użyj filtrów, aby pobierać filmy według określonych tagów, słów kluczowych lub dat publikacji.

4. Dostosowanie struktury arkusza

Zmodyfikuj strukturę Arkusza2, aby kategoryzować filmy według kryteriów takich jak:

  • Kanał
  • Status filmu (np. "Opublikowany", "Zaplanowany")
  • Typ filmu (np. "Poradnik", "Recenzja")

5. Zaplanowanie regularnego pobierania

Ustaw wyzwalacz harmonogramu, aby pobierać filmy w regularnych odstępach czasu (np. codziennie lub tygodniowo), zapewniając automatyczne dodawanie nowych treści do arkusza.

6. Dostosowanie układu arkusza Google

Zmień układ Arkusza2, aby lepiej odpowiadał Twoim potrzebom. Na przykład możesz dodać dodatkowe kolumny dla:

  • Kategorii treści
  • Oceny filmu
  • Linków do mediów społecznościowych

```

   Skopiuj kod szablonu   
{"id":"rJNvM4vU6SLUeC1d","meta":{"instanceId":"10f6e8a86649316fe7041c503c24e6d77b68a961a9f4f1f76d0100c435446092","templateCredsSetupCompleted":true},"name":"Sync Youtube Video Urls with Google Sheets","tags":[],"nodes":[{"id":"f1cd1374-2214-41c1-af32-9e31e72aab88","name":"Split Out","type":"n8n-nodes-base.splitOut","position":[1720,0],"parameters":{"options":{},"fieldToSplitOut":"items"},"typeVersion":1},{"id":"e59d5ac8-5386-4fa4-a18c-39cd84779eae","name":"Manual Trigger (When Clicking 'Test workflow'","type":"n8n-nodes-base.manualTrigger","position":[1100,0],"parameters":{},"typeVersion":1},{"id":"46897f6d-5e64-4a85-92b5-d8e596d02702","name":"Get Youtube Channel Ids from Google Sheet","type":"n8n-nodes-base.googleSheets","position":[1300,0],"parameters":{"options":{},"sheetName":{"__rl":true,"mode":"list","value":1592454760,"cachedResultUrl":"https://docs.google.com/spreadsheets/d/1xoCVr_mlwn4jFcnJENtrU-_K5nkIytZ8qBXzxMq55n4/edit#gid=1592454760","cachedResultName":"Sheet3"},"documentId":{"__rl":true,"mode":"list","value":"1xoCVr_mlwn4jFcnJENtrU-_K5nkIytZ8qBXzxMq55n4","cachedResultUrl":"https://docs.google.com/spreadsheets/d/1xoCVr_mlwn4jFcnJENtrU-_K5nkIytZ8qBXzxMq55n4/edit?usp=drivesdk","cachedResultName":"Youtube Videos Comments"},"authentication":"serviceAccount"},"credentials":{"googleApi":{"id":"jPoTdPxgVL0vr9SQ","name":"Google Sheets account"}},"typeVersion":4.5},{"id":"adb73854-a110-4c1e-9228-221b844a15f5","name":"Get Youtube Video Urls form specific channel","type":"n8n-nodes-base.httpRequest","position":[1540,0],"parameters":{"url":"https://www.googleapis.com/youtube/v3/search","options":{"pagination":{"pagination":{"parameters":{"parameters":[{"name":"pageToken","value":"={{ $response.body.nextPageToken }}"}]},"completeExpression":"={{ !$response.body.nextPageToken}}","paginationCompleteWhen":"other"}}},"sendQuery":true,"authentication":"genericCredentialType","genericAuthType":"httpQueryAuth","queryParameters":{"parameters":[{"name":"channelId","value":"={{ $json.channelId }}"},{"name":"part","value":"snippet"},{"name":"order","value":"date"},{"name":"maxResults","value":"50"}]}},"credentials":{"httpQueryAuth":{"id":"2lgO4p3deoSAoU9d","name":"Query Auth account 3"}},"typeVersion":4.2},{"id":"d5926bd7-f1d6-4441-87de-454d16aa6928","name":"Format fields as required to save in google sheet","type":"n8n-nodes-base.set","position":[1900,0],"parameters":{"options":{},"assignments":{"assignments":[{"id":"21a7a279-8a86-494c-a32f-ebcf956e2f69","name":"Title","type":"string","value":"={{ $json.snippet.title }}"},{"id":"0f7084f4-9180-4eee-ab59-8e0ce75b163f","name":"video_urls","type":"string","value":"=https://www.youtube.com/watch?v={{ $json.id.videoId }}"},{"id":"40b96174-109e-4ddf-b1c2-c3f0b93a2769","name":"published_at","type":"string","value":"={{ $json.snippet.publishedAt }}"}]}},"typeVersion":3.4},{"id":"e23503cd-40ae-488f-9918-83b1e3dc7b28","name":"Insert & Update Youtube Urls in Google Sheet","type":"n8n-nodes-base.googleSheets","position":[2100,0],"parameters":{"columns":{"value":{"Title":"={{ $json.Title }}","video_urls":"={{ $json.video_urls }}","published_at":"={{ $json.published_at }}"},"schema":[{"id":"Title","type":"string","display":true,"removed":false,"required":false,"displayName":"Title","defaultMatch":false,"canBeUsedToMatch":true},{"id":"video_urls","type":"string","display":true,"removed":false,"required":false,"displayName":"video_urls","defaultMatch":false,"canBeUsedToMatch":true},{"id":"last_fetched_time","type":"string","display":true,"removed":true,"required":false,"displayName":"last_fetched_time","defaultMatch":false,"canBeUsedToMatch":true},{"id":"next_fetch_time","type":"string","display":true,"removed":true,"required":false,"displayName":"next_fetch_time","defaultMatch":false,"canBeUsedToMatch":true},{"id":"published_at","type":"string","display":true,"removed":false,"required":false,"displayName":"published_at","defaultMatch":false,"canBeUsedToMatch":true}],"mappingMode":"defineBelow","matchingColumns":["video_urls"],"attemptToConvertTypes":false,"convertFieldsToString":false},"options":{},"operation":"appendOrUpdate","sheetName":{"__rl":true,"mode":"list","value":760258523,"cachedResultUrl":"https://docs.google.com/spreadsheets/d/1xoCVr_mlwn4jFcnJENtrU-_K5nkIytZ8qBXzxMq55n4/edit#gid=760258523","cachedResultName":"Sheet2"},"documentId":{"__rl":true,"mode":"list","value":"1xoCVr_mlwn4jFcnJENtrU-_K5nkIytZ8qBXzxMq55n4","cachedResultUrl":"https://docs.google.com/spreadsheets/d/1xoCVr_mlwn4jFcnJENtrU-_K5nkIytZ8qBXzxMq55n4/edit?usp=drivesdk","cachedResultName":"Youtube Videos Comments"},"authentication":"serviceAccount"},"credentials":{"googleApi":{"id":"jPoTdPxgVL0vr9SQ","name":"Google Sheets account"}},"typeVersion":4.5},{"id":"428bf48c-1721-4215-9ad4-f5b85f12d6dc","name":"Sticky Note","type":"n8n-nodes-base.stickyNote","position":[1020,-100],"parameters":{"width":1320,"height":320,"content":"## Sync Youtube Video Urls with Google Sheetsn"},"typeVersion":1},{"id":"3aaf62a9-e97e-48dd-8716-c5440759a03e","name":"Sticky Note1","type":"n8n-nodes-base.stickyNote","position":[720,-100],"parameters":{"color":5,"width":280,"height":220,"content":"## I'm a note n✅ Reads Channel IDs from `Sheet3` n📹 Fetches video URLs using YouTube API n📄 Writes video URLs to `Sheet2` nn🔁 Output used in: n👉 [Part 2 – YouTube Comment Sentiment Analyzer](https://n8n.io/workflows/3855-youtube-comment-sentiment-analyzer-with-google-sheets-and-openai/)"},"typeVersion":1}],"active":false,"pinData":{},"settings":{"executionOrder":"v1"},"versionId":"f874513c-62c9-430d-8c33-c6d48bacb74d","connections":{"Split Out":{"main":[[{"node":"Format fields as required to save in google sheet","type":"main","index":0}]]},"Get Youtube Channel Ids from Google Sheet":{"main":[[{"node":"Get Youtube Video Urls form specific channel","type":"main","index":0}]]},"Get Youtube Video Urls form specific channel":{"main":[[{"node":"Split Out","type":"main","index":0}]]},"Manual Trigger (When Clicking 'Test workflow'":{"main":[[{"node":"Get Youtube Channel Ids from Google Sheet","type":"main","index":0}]]},"Format fields as required to save in google sheet":{"main":[[{"node":"Insert & Update Youtube Urls in Google Sheet","type":"main","index":0}]]}}}
  • CSV
  • Sheet
  • Spreadsheet
  • GS
  • API
  • Request
  • URL
  • Build
  • cURL
Planeta AI 2025 
magic-wandmenu linkedin facebook pinterest youtube rss twitter instagram facebook-blank rss-blank linkedin-blank pinterest youtube twitter instagram